Pressure Vessel Assessment Spreadsheet

This document contains input parameters for assessing the condition of a nozzle, shell, and head. It includes the design pressure and temperature, material properties, dimensions, wall thicknesses, and corrosion rates. Minimum wall thicknesses are calculated based on ASME code requirements. The nozzle size table lists minimum thicknesses from the ASME code for different nozzle sizes. Material property tables provide the allowable stresses for various steel grades at different temperatures.

Nozzle Size B36.10M Data ASME VIII Table UG-45
Nozzle NPS Nozzel outer diameter mm tmin mm
0.5 21.3 2.96
0.75 26.7 2.96
1 33.4 2.96
1.5 42.2 3.22
2 60.3 3.42
3 88.9 4.8
4 114.3 5.27
5 141.3 5.27 Assumed
6 168.3 6.22
8 219.1 7.16
10 273 8.11
12 323.8 8.34
